A fast, accessible, and pretty command palette for React
The command palette for React offers a robust and customizable solution for building an interactive command interface within web applications. It empowers developers to create seamless user experiences by enabling quick access to functionalities via a sleek command palette. With its accessibility and flexibility, this package is perfect for developers looking to enhance the usability of their applications without compromising on aesthetics or performance.
This package not only allows for straightforward installation but also provides a collection of components that can be easily integrated. Whether you want to build a fully customized command palette or utilize the pre-built options, this toolkit caters to varying levels of expertise, making it accessible for both new and seasoned developers.

Headless UI is a set of completely unstyled, fully accessible UI components for React, Vue, and Alpine.js that empower developers to build their own fully accessible custom UI components. Headless UI allows developers to focus on building accessible and highly functional user interfaces, without the need to worry about styling or layout.
PostCSS is a popular open-source tool that enables web developers to transform CSS styles with JavaScript plugins. It allows for efficient processing of CSS styles, from applying vendor prefixes to improving browser compatibility, ultimately resulting in cleaner, faster, and more maintainable code.
TypeScript is a superset of JavaScript, providing optional static typing, classes, interfaces, and other features that help developers write more maintainable and scalable code. TypeScript's static typing system can catch errors at compile-time, making it easier to build and maintain large applications.
Webpack is a popular open-source module bundler for JavaScript applications that bundles and optimizes the code and its dependencies for production-ready deployment. It can also be used to transform other types of assets such as CSS, images, and fonts.
